-package com.lowagie.text.pdf;
-import java.io.IOException;
-import java.io.InputStream;
-import java.util.HashMap;
-import java.util.ArrayList;
-import java.net.URL;
-/** Reads an FDF form and makes the fields available
- * @author Paulo Soares (psoares@consiste.pt)
- */
-public class FdfReader extends PdfReader {
-
- HashMap fields;
- String fileSpec;
- PdfName encoding;
-
- /** Reads an FDF form.
- * @param filename the file name of the form
- * @throws IOException on error
- */
- public FdfReader(String filename) throws IOException {
- super(filename);
- }
-
- /** Reads an FDF form.
- * @param pdfIn the byte array with the form
- * @throws IOException on error
- */
- public FdfReader(byte pdfIn[]) throws IOException {
- super(pdfIn);
- }
-
- /** Reads an FDF form.
- * @param url the URL of the document
- * @throws IOException on error
- */
- public FdfReader(URL url) throws IOException {
- super(url);
- }
-
- /** Reads an FDF form.
- * @param is the <CODE>InputStream</CODE> containing the document. The stream is read to the
- * end but is not closed
- * @throws IOException on error
- */
- public FdfReader(InputStream is) throws IOException {
- super(is);
- }
-
- protected void readPdf() throws IOException {
- fields = new HashMap();
- try {
- tokens.checkFdfHeader();
- rebuildXref();
- readDocObj();
- }
- finally {
- try {
- tokens.close();
- }
- catch (Exception e) {
- // empty on purpose
- }
- }
- readFields();
- }
-
- protected void kidNode(PdfDictionary merged, String name) {
- PdfArray kids = (PdfArray)getPdfObject(merged.get(PdfName.KIDS));
- if (kids == null || kids.getArrayList().size() == 0) {
- if (name.length() > 0)
- name = name.substring(1);
- fields.put(name, merged);
- }
- else {
- merged.remove(PdfName.KIDS);
- ArrayList ar = kids.getArrayList();
- for (int k = 0; k < ar.size(); ++k) {
- PdfDictionary dic = new PdfDictionary();
- dic.merge(merged);
- PdfDictionary newDic = (PdfDictionary)getPdfObject((PdfObject)ar.get(k));
- PdfString t = (PdfString)getPdfObject(newDic.get(PdfName.T));
- String newName = name;
- if (t != null)
- newName += "." + t.toUnicodeString();
- dic.merge(newDic);
- dic.remove(PdfName.T);
- kidNode(dic, newName);
- }
- }
- }
-
- protected void readFields() throws IOException {
- catalog = (PdfDictionary)getPdfObject(trailer.get(PdfName.ROOT));
- PdfDictionary fdf = (PdfDictionary)getPdfObject(catalog.get(PdfName.FDF));
- PdfString fs = (PdfString)getPdfObject(fdf.get(PdfName.F));
- if (fs != null)
- fileSpec = fs.toUnicodeString();
- PdfArray fld = (PdfArray)getPdfObject(fdf.get(PdfName.FIELDS));
- if (fld == null)
- return;
- encoding = (PdfName)getPdfObject(fdf.get(PdfName.ENCODING));
- PdfDictionary merged = new PdfDictionary();
- merged.put(PdfName.KIDS, fld);
- kidNode(merged, "");
- }
-
- /** Gets all the fields. The map is keyed by the fully qualified
- * field name and the value is a merged <CODE>PdfDictionary</CODE>
- * with the field content.
- * @return all the fields
- */
- public HashMap getFields() {
- return fields;
- }
-
- /** Gets the field dictionary.
- * @param name the fully qualified field name
- * @return the field dictionary
- */
- public PdfDictionary getField(String name) {
- return (PdfDictionary)fields.get(name);
- }
-
- /** Gets the field value or <CODE>null</CODE> if the field does not
- * exist or has no value defined.
- * @param name the fully qualified field name
- * @return the field value or <CODE>null</CODE>
- */
- public String getFieldValue(String name) {
- PdfDictionary field = (PdfDictionary)fields.get(name);
- if (field == null)
- return null;
- PdfObject v = getPdfObject(field.get(PdfName.V));
- if (v == null)
- return null;
- if (v.isName())
- return PdfName.decodeName(((PdfName)v).toString());
- else if (v.isString()) {
- PdfString vs = (PdfString)v;
- if (encoding == null || vs.getEncoding() != null)
- return vs.toUnicodeString();
- byte b[] = vs.getBytes();
- if (b.length >= 2 && b[0] == (byte)254 && b[1] == (byte)255)
- return vs.toUnicodeString();
- try {
- if (encoding.equals(PdfName.SHIFT_JIS))
- return new String(b, "SJIS");
- else if (encoding.equals(PdfName.UHC))
- return new String(b, "MS949");
- else if (encoding.equals(PdfName.GBK))
- return new String(b, "GBK");
- else if (encoding.equals(PdfName.BIGFIVE))
- return new String(b, "Big5");
- }
- catch (Exception e) {
- }
- return vs.toUnicodeString();
- }
- return null;
- }
-
- /** Gets the PDF file specification contained in the FDF.
- * @return the PDF file specification contained in the FDF
- */
- public String getFileSpec() {
- return fileSpec;
- }
-} \ No newline at end of file
